Stratigraphy
Formation:Hiraiso
Stratigraphic resolution:bed
Stratigraphy comments: Bando (1970) originally considered the age of the Hiraiso Formation to be Griesbachian (early Induan) based on a single ammonoid identified as Glyptophiceras cf. gracile from a floated block of siltstone, which possibly came from the Osawa Formation (Ehiro, 2002). Later, Nakazawa et al. (1994) attributed the specimen to G. aequicostatus and assigned it a late Smithian age. However, our examination of the specimen indicates that it is not G. aequicostatus, and instead should be assigned to the early Spathian ammonoid Neocolumbites Zakharov.
